Nail Psoriasis

Nail psoriasis is a form of psoriasis that affects the nails, causing visible changes such as spots, depressions, or thickening. This chronic inflammatory disease can lead to pain and infections if not properly managed. Treatments include topical creams, photodynamic therapies, or systemic medications to control inflammation and improve the appearance of the nails.
